Summary
Indemnity agreements in public works contracts. Provides that a statute that invalidates indemnity agreements in construction contracts relating to providing certain professional services is applicable to such contracts relating to public works projects. Provides that a specified chapter does not apply to: (1) projects covered by INDOT's contractor qualification statute; or (2) a project that is the construction, improvement, alteration, repair, or maintenance of a highway, street, or road. Provides that a BOT agreement may provide for the transfer of a public facility to a governmental body by means of a lease or an installment contract. Defines certain terms.
